Transaction 423081fa6a00e72866f7c5f57bc26670d157c0cc60a15c1cfbe98a93363b34dd
1 Input
1 Output
-
423081fa6a00e72866f7c5f57bc26670d157c0cc60a15c1cfbe98a93363b34dd:0
- value
- 326462
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d67047db83e920a413abebbdf9f632a8c701bf90 OP_EQUAL
- address
- 3MEs2zemFqgkfaSqV2W4SzAwFaVA8aDmbv